The Sims 4 X Black Lives Matter: Update

Sul Sul Simmers,


During these trying times, we know that everyone is looking for an escape and The Sims 4 is here to provide that for its players. On behalf of the Gurus and Maxis™, we would like to say that we stand with the Black Community as our families, friends and our players. The Sims 4 is dedicated and predicated on ensuring diversity and inclusivity for our players. We have heard you all loud and clear! So, on November 9th, 2020, we are making three major updates to the game!


The first update will be directly impacting the base game Create-A-Sim assets. We will be extending the values on the lip, nose and weight sliders. With this update, we are extending the limits of your creativity and ensuring that our Simmers can create more unique and diverse sims to strengthen their storytelling and gameplay experience.


The second update is addressing skin-tones. Over the last few years, as a team, we have realized we have not been fully listening to our fanbase. For that, we sincerely apologize. To make it up to you avid Simmers out there, we will be implementing a dual-skin tone colour wheel which will allow Simmers of every race around the world to be able to finely detail both the skin tone and the under hue of your Sims in-game. No more will you have to complain about the ashy and dry darker skin tones that our game had for Black Sims or the lack thereof lighter tones for Asian simmers. We are ensuring that you can make yourself, your families, your friends and much more in the world you create.


Lastly, we are announcing our partnering with Black Lives Matter. We have worked with a few of our African American game changers, our teams' creative directors and core members of the Black Lives Matter movement to create several clothing items with a Black Lives Matter theme, this will include shirts and sweaters with 10 swatches of several different designs and colours for every sim life state. Along with this, 30% of our profits from our next expansion pack will be donated to the Black Lives Matter movement and bail funds across the country.


Inclusivity and representation is the goal of The Sims™

As we progress, we hope to enhance the gaming experience for our entire player base.
